Forgetting Sarah Marshall:
This latest Judd Apatow offering is about a man dumped by his hottie girlfriend and not being able to get away from her, even after traveling to Hawaii. This looks like a good Apatow Rom/Com, so I'm going to say it does closer to 40 Year Old Virgin and Superbad type business rather than Drillbit Taylor. I'm not expecting the R rating to hurt this , as Apatow's R rated do better than his PG-13 offerings.
Estimate: 19-22 Million
88 Minutes:
Al Pacino has had his not-so-good performances in the box office, but his cop drama/thrillers tend to do better than his other movies. The movies TV spots and trailer look half way decent, so I would say the typical movie goer has no idea that this is a turd being given a "token" release. Tight competition is going to hold this way back along with Pacino's fading popularity.
Estimate: 7-10 Million
